AI Tutorial Bubbles: A Deep Dive into Accessible AI Education341


The world of Artificial Intelligence (AI) is rapidly evolving, presenting both incredible opportunities and daunting complexities. For many, the sheer volume of technical jargon and advanced mathematical concepts can feel like an insurmountable barrier to entry. This is where the concept of "AI Tutorial Bubbles" comes into play – a pedagogical approach designed to break down complex AI topics into easily digestible, bite-sized pieces.

Imagine learning AI not as a daunting climb up a sheer cliff face, but as a gentle stroll through a whimsical landscape, encountering new concepts within playful, interactive "bubbles." Each bubble represents a specific AI concept, explained clearly and concisely, with interactive elements to enhance understanding. This approach caters to a diverse range of learners, from complete beginners with no prior programming experience to seasoned developers seeking to expand their AI knowledge.

The effectiveness of AI Tutorial Bubbles rests on several key principles:

1. Modularity and Granularity: Instead of presenting a monolithic explanation of a complex algorithm, like a Convolutional Neural Network (CNN), the information is broken down into smaller, manageable chunks. One bubble might explain the concept of convolution, another the pooling layer, and another the activation function. This modularity allows learners to grasp each component individually before integrating them into a holistic understanding.

2. Visual and Interactive Learning: AI concepts often involve abstract mathematical principles. AI Tutorial Bubbles leverage visual aids, such as animations, diagrams, and interactive simulations, to make these concepts more intuitive and engaging. For instance, a bubble explaining backpropagation could use an animation to visually demonstrate the flow of gradients through the network.

3. Practical Application and Hands-on Exercises: Understanding AI is not just about theoretical knowledge; it's also about applying that knowledge to solve real-world problems. Each bubble should ideally include small, manageable coding exercises or interactive simulations that allow learners to apply the concepts they've learned. This active learning approach significantly enhances retention and reinforces understanding.

4. Gamification and Rewards: Introducing elements of gamification, such as points, badges, and leaderboards, can significantly boost learner engagement and motivation. Completing a bubble could unlock a new one, creating a sense of progression and accomplishment. This positive reinforcement can keep learners motivated and encourage them to explore more advanced topics.

5. Personalized Learning Paths: AI Tutorial Bubbles should ideally offer personalized learning paths, adapting to the individual learner's pace and level of understanding. This might involve suggesting additional resources or skipping certain bubbles based on the learner's prior knowledge and progress.

Example Bubble Topics:

The structure of AI Tutorial Bubbles allows for a vast range of topics. Here are some examples of individual "bubbles" that could be included in a comprehensive curriculum:
What is AI? – A foundational bubble defining AI and its various subfields.
Supervised Learning: An introduction to supervised learning, including regression and classification.
Unsupervised Learning: Exploring clustering and dimensionality reduction techniques.
Reinforcement Learning: An overview of reinforcement learning and its applications.
Neural Networks: A simplified explanation of neural networks, including perceptrons and multi-layer perceptrons.
Backpropagation: A visual explanation of the backpropagation algorithm.
Convolutional Neural Networks (CNNs): A modular breakdown of CNNs, explaining convolution, pooling, and activation functions.
Recurrent Neural Networks (RNNs): An introduction to RNNs and their use in sequential data processing.
Natural Language Processing (NLP): An overview of NLP techniques, such as tokenization and sentiment analysis.
Computer Vision: An introduction to computer vision techniques, including image classification and object detection.
Bias in AI: A critical discussion of bias in AI algorithms and its societal implications.
Ethical Considerations in AI: Exploring the ethical challenges posed by AI development and deployment.
AI Tools and Libraries: An introduction to popular AI tools and libraries, such as TensorFlow and PyTorch.
Building Your First AI Model: A hands-on tutorial guiding learners through the process of building a simple AI model.
Deploying AI Models: An overview of methods for deploying AI models into real-world applications.

Conclusion:

AI Tutorial Bubbles represent a powerful and innovative approach to AI education. By breaking down complex concepts into easily digestible modules, incorporating interactive elements, and emphasizing practical application, this method can democratize access to AI knowledge and empower a new generation of AI enthusiasts and professionals. The playful and engaging nature of this approach makes learning fun and accessible, fostering a deeper understanding and appreciation of this transformative technology.

2025-03-24


Previous:Best Audio Editing Software: A Comprehensive Guide to Downloads and Tutorials

Next:Unlocking the Cloud: A Deep Dive into Li Shuang‘s Cloud Computing Expertise